A react component expects either a string, another component, or an array of components. For loops do not return any of these. This is why we have to store the value of the for loop in a variable and return the variable. See How To Loop Inside React JSX - React FAQ or this answer. – Victor Ofoegbu. WebJul 5, 2024 · Here are 3 potential causes of the infinite loop in React. I. Updating the state inside the render function App() { const [count, setCount] = useState(0); setCount(1); // infinite loop return ... } If you update the state directly inside your render method or a body of a functional component, it will cause an infinite loop.
